Ingredients
  

12 oz fresh cheese tortellini

2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il

4 cloves garlic, finely minced

6 cups fresh spinach, roughly chopped

1 cup heavy cream

½ c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ese

1 teaspoon freshly grated lemon zest

½ te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ional, adjust to taste)

Salt and freshly cracked black pepper to taste

Fresh basil leaves, for garnish

Instructions
 

Cook the Tortellini: Begin by bringing a large pot of salted water to a rolling boil. Carefully add the fresh tortellini and cook according to the package instructions until they reach an al dente texture. Once cooked, drain the pasta in a colander and set aside, reserving a small cup of the pasta cooking water in case you need to adjust the sauce later.

    Sauté the Garlic: In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. When the oil is shimmering, add the minced garlic, and sauté for about 1 minute. Stir frequently until the garlic is aromatic but not browned, as burnt garlic can taste bitter.

      Add the Spinach: Gradually stir in the chopped spinach. Cook for about 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ally until the spinach has wilted and reduced in volume. This will add a wonderful depth of flavor to your dish.

        Make the Creamy Sauce: Pour the heavy cream into the skillet, allowing it to come to a gentle simmer over low heat. Once simmering, add the freshly grated Parmesan cheese, lemon zest, and red pepper flakes (if using). Stir continuously until the cheese is fully melted, and the sauce becomes silky smooth. If the sauce is too thick, add a splash of the reserved pasta water until the desired consistency is reached.

          Combine Tortellini with Sauce: Carefully add the drained tortellini to the creamy spinach sauce. Using a spatula or tongs, gently toss the tortellini to ensure they are nicely coated in the sauce. Taste and adjust seasoning with salt and freshly cracked black pepper as needed.

            Serve and Garnish: Once the tortellini is thoroughly mixed with the sauce and heated through, remove the skillet from heat. Dish out the creamy garlic spinach tortellini onto serving plates and garnish with fresh basil leaves. For an extra touch, sprinkle additional grated Parmesan over the top.

              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 10 minutes | 30 minutes | Serves 4
